Quick Reference

The FMMT618 is a NPN bipolar junction transistor in a SOT-23 package, manufactured by Shikues. It supports a breakdown voltage of 20V and continuous collector current of 1.5A. It is widely used in switching and amplification circuits.

Technical Specifications

ParameterValueDescription
ManufacturerShikuesOriginal Manufacturer
PackageSOT-23Physical mounting
Transistor TypeBJTBipolar Junction Transistor
CategorySingleConfiguration
Collector-Emitter Voltage (VCEO)20VMax breakdown voltage
Collector Current (Ic)1.5AMax current handling
Power Dissipation (Pd)625mWMax thermal limit
DC Current Gain (hFE)200Base signal amplification ratio
Transition Frequency (fT)140MHzMax operating frequency
Saturation Voltage (VCEsat)200mVVoltage drop when fully ON
Emitter-Base Voltage (Vebo)5VMax emitter-base breakdown
Collector Cutoff Current100nALeakage current when OFF
Operating Temp-55โ„ƒ~+150โ„ƒSafe junction temperature range
